A Waldorf teenager was arrested after breaking into his school and releasing dozens of crickets as part of a senior prank.
Authorities said Jinhan Kim, 18, entered Thomas Stone High School through a window he had unlocked earlier that day and emptied a bag of 150 crickets onto the floor. He was arrested after he said he returned to his car near a wooded area, where police responded to a report of suspicious people.
Kim was charged with burglary and possessing burglary tools because officers found a screwdriver in his pocket.

Four teenagers were injured after a driver passed out as part of a breath-holding game and crashed, New York sheriff's deputies said.
The teens said they were holding their breath when driver Bryan Parslow, 19, blacked out and lost control of the car. The vehicle hit a tree and a boulder.
Alcohol was not a factor in the accident, authorities said.

A 63-year-old New Jersey man was arrested for reaching under the blanket of a sleeping woman aboard a Continental flight and fondling her.
Ramesh Advani allegedly touched the woman's private parts all while he moved "napkins around inside of his pants," court papers said.
Two passengers witnessed the alleged sexual assault and kicked the woman's chair in an attempt to wake her up.
Advani was arrested when the flight from Hong Kong landed in Newark.
